找回密码
 立即注册
查看: 2679|回复: 0

Tizen开发基本输入小部件代码

[复制链接]
发表于 2015-8-22 18:08:01 | 显示全部楼层 |阅读模式
这个代码片段演示了如何创建一个条目小部件和执行一些基本的操作。
  1. Evas_Object* entry = elm_entry_add(ad->win);
  2. evas_object_size_hint_weight_set(entry, EVAS_HINT_EXPAND, EVAS_HINT_EXPAND);
  3. evas_object_size_hint_align_set(entry, EVAS_HINT_FILL, EVAS_HINT_FILL);

  4. //single line
  5. elm_entry_single_line_set(entry, EINA_TRUE);

  6. //set entry text
  7. elm_entry_entry_set(entry, "text");

  8. //insert text at current cursor position (here beginning)
  9. elm_entry_entry_insert(entry, "sample ");

  10. //set entry to password mode
  11. elm_entry_password_set(entry, EINA_TRUE);

  12. //disable entry editing
  13. elm_entry_editable_set(entry, EINA_FALSE);

  14. evas_object_show(entry);
  15. elm_object_content_set(ad->conform, entry);

  16. //get entry text
  17. const char* text = elm_entry_entry_get(entry);
  18. dlog_print(DLOG_DEBUG, LOG_TAG, "Entry text: %s", text);
复制代码

欢迎来到泰泽网:http://www.tizennet.com/ 泰泽论坛:http://bbs.tizennet.com/ 好没有内涵哦,快到设置中更改这个无聊的签名吧!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|泰泽应用|泰泽论坛|泰泽网|小黑屋|Archiver|手机版|泰泽邮箱|泰泽网 ( 蜀ICP备13024062号-1 )

GMT+8, 2024-4-19 21:25 , Processed in 0.090140 second(s), 20 queries .

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表